Internet Access Policy

The Future Corporation realizes that a connection to the Internet is important to company business, yet having such a connection creates security risks. The Internet Access Policy defines guidelines for accessing the Internet.

Acceptable Use

The Future Corporation employees may openly use outbound access to the Internet for company research. Dial-in users may gain outbound access to the Internet. Reasonable constraints on total logon time and idle time should be determined and implemented.
